Ronald Stretton
Ronald Charles Stretton (born February 13, 1930 in Epsom , Surrey , Great Britain , † November 12, 2012 in Toronto , Ontario , Canada ) was a British track cyclist who started for the Norwood Paragon Cycling Club. At the Olympic Summer Games in Helsinki in 1952 , he won the bronze medal in the team pursuit together with Don Burgess , George Newberry and Alan Newton .
He moved to Toronto from Great Britain in 1955 and became a Canadian citizen in 1978.
